Power Supply Controllers, Monitors NXP Semiconductors TEA1610T/N6,518 Overview
The TEA1610T/N6,518, a resonant converter controller from NXP Semiconductors, stands out in the realm of Power Supply Controllers and Monitors. This IC is specifically designed to drive high-efficiency, low-EMI power supplies using a zero-voltage switching resonant topology. Its robust build and integrated features enable precise control, making it an essential component for developers seeking reliability and performance. The TEA1610T/N6,518 facilitates compact design while enhancing the overall efficiency and operational lifespan of applications, thus embodying an ideal solution for high-performance power systems. TEA1610T/N6,518 Features
The TEA1610T/N6,518 offers multiple features that enhance its utility in power supply applications. These include a wide supply voltage range, high current drive capability, and protection mechanisms such as over-temperature and over-current protection. Its efficiency is further augmented by the inclusion of frequency modulation for reduced electromagnetic interference, making it suitable for sensitive electronic equipment.
